Find Nature & History on the Tuatapere Hump Ridge Track

The Tuatapere Hump Ridge Track is New Zealand's newest walking track. It provides a wide variety of scenery during the three day/two night walking experience. The track passes through the world famous Waitutu coastal marine terraces, podocarp and beech forest, sub-alpine settings and spectacular sandstone outcrops.

Walkers see unique wildlife, including seals, Hector's dolphins and kea. The area is rich in history from both Maori and European cultures. Key attractions are the recently restored Percy Burn Viaduct and the Edwin, Sandhill and Francis Burn Viaducts.
